Kim Kardashian filed for divorce from Kanye West after 6 years of marriage and months of rumors of the trouble going on between them. While she cried about it on her show, she hasn’t seemed interested in getting back together with Kanye since and has been spotted out and about with Pete Davidson–who recently showed off a hickey on one of their dinner dates. But that won’t stop Ye, who talked about “Kimye” fondly to the poor folks of Los Angeles. Via TMZ:

During his speech, Ye says he’s done things in public that were “not acceptable as a husband,” but believes “The Kingdom” aka God will help to repair things with Kim. Ye believes if they reconcile, millions of families coping with divorce or separation could be inspired to do the same thing. He got big applause for that message. He also mentioned his kids, saying he needs to be with them as much as possible and if he can’t be “in the house” he’ll get a house right next door.

And, let there be no doubt, Ye clearly still has issues with the Kardashian family living on reality TV — he insisted he’ll be the one to write his family’s history, not a streaming service like Hulu, Disney or E!
